The USA is well loved for its rugged red rocks, dynamic cities and world famous national parks. But America's backyard is one of the most diverse in the world, and any journey through the States is likely to throw up some surprises. Here is six places you won't believe exist in America. Pictured Rocks National Lakeshore, Michigan: The Pictured Rocks National Lakeshore, with its coves and colorful cliff faces, is among the most beautiful spots in the Midwest. The secluded sea grotto's wouldn't look out of place along the Mediterranean, but they've been hollowed out by Lake Superior. The vibrant Pictured Rocks rise some 200 feet above the lake, colored red, orange, blue and green by the minerals that have seeped into their surface. White Pass and Yukon Route Railroad, Skagway, Alaska: This railway route touts itself as the most scenic in the world, and it's not hard to see why. The snow-dusted mountains, pink and yellow wild flowers and rambling hills appear almost Alpine. The railroad, whose construction began in 1898, instead rattles through Alaska towards Canada, leaving from the little city of Skagway. Midway Ice Castles, Utah: These undulating ice terraces look as though they belong in the Arctic. They're actually man-made, the vision of Utah-based architect Brent Christensen, who erects these icy towers in the city of Midway come winter. Each of the dazzling castles, with its hand-shaped turrets and tunnels, weigh around 25,000,000 pounds, and draw visitors from all over Utah and beyond. Nāpali Coast State Wilderness Park, Hawaii: The rugged red and green rocks of Hawaii's Nāpali Coast State Wilderness Park look more suited to Mars than Earth. 'Na Pali' means 'high cliffs', and the tallest mountains here soar to 4,000 feet. The best way to take in the prismatic peaks is from the Kalalau Trail, a hardy, 11-mile route that rewards its hikers with a sandy beach at the end. The trail is currently closed (due to damage caused by flooding), but you can check the trail site for details of its reopening. Boldt Castle, New York: The USA is not known for its fortresses, but this European-inspired castle in New York's Alexandria Bay delivers. It was built in the early 1900s for millionaire George C. Boldt and his beloved wife, who passed during its construction, leading Boldt to abandon his extravagant project. With its Italian-style gardens and whimsical turrets, it rivals the many castles on the Continent for sheer fairy-tale factor. Turnip Rock, Michigan: Twenty-foot-tall trees sprout from this unusual rock formation in Port Austin. Thought to resemble a turnip due to its squat shape and the generous greenery on its surface, the rock has been formed by the wear and tear of the waves over millennia. You can rent kayaks from the mainland and paddle out to see the structure (since much of its surrounding land is private, it's not possible to see if from the shore).The round trip is seven miles, so best suits those with some kayaking experience.
